> Remember Nelson's Maxim: there are no problems, only unmet business > opportunities. If you can figure out a way to save people money > through your actions, then you can convince them to share a portion of > those savings with you, triggering your action. I think the second statement is close to true, but at the same time very wrong. The reason we have this list is that it must be phrased as: "If you can save a person money through your actions, then it would benefit them to share a portion of those savings with you if it triggered your action and the transaction costs were not too high."
